Cai Wei, also known as Songpo, was born on December 18, 1882 in Shaoyang, Hunan Province. He is a famous politician, military strategist and democratic revolutionary in modern China.

Cai Wei has been an excellent student since he was a child, and met Liang Qichao at the age of 16. Liang Qichao was a democratic-minded university scholar, and under his guidance, Cai accepted a series of ideas for restoration, and he supported the republic and opposed the imperial system.

After graduating from the Japanese Army Non-Commissioned Officer School and returning to China, Cai Wei served as the commander of the new army in Yunnan. On October 10, 1911, the Xinhai Revolution led by Sun Yat-sen broke out, and Cai Wei immediately responded by launching an uprising in Yunnan and declaring Yunnan's independence, and he served as the governor of Yunnan. Later, Yuan Shikai became interim president and transferred Cai Wei to Beijing.

Yuan Shikai played a duplicitous trick, on the one hand, he forced the emperor of the Qing Dynasty to abdicate, and on the other hand, he killed the "Six Gentlemen of Pengxi" who changed the law of restoration, accepted Article 21, and wanted to restore the imperial system and become the emperor himself. Yuan Shikai's dream of the Yellow Emperor was fulfilled for 82 days, and he collapsed amid the criticism of the people of the whole country.

General Cai Wei was resolutely opposed to Yuan Shikai's proclamation as emperor, and in order to fight against Wei Shikai, with the help of Xiao Fengxian, Cai Wei traveled from Beijing to Tianjin, entered Japan, traveled to Yunnan, and then raised troops against Yuan.

In September 1916, General Cai Wei became seriously ill and was sent to Japan for medical treatment. Before he died, he said with deep regret: The great powers invaded China, I cannot die in foreign wars, I cannot die in the shroud of Mag, I cannot make greater contributions to the country, although I die, I have regrets!
